Liverpool set to recall player after causing problems at his loan club with role which left team-mates 'astonished'

The Reds' man has not enjoyed his time out on loan and could be set to return to Liverpool.

Liverpool could be set to ‘terminate’ a player’s loan, which would see him return to the club in January - but a Spanish club are 'interested'.

Arne Slot will no doubt be pleased with his start to life on Merseyside. His side currently sit top of both the Premier League and 36-team group stage at the season’s halfway point.

Tomorrow, they are set to take on Ruben Amorim’s Manchester United at Anfield, having previously convincingly beaten the Red Devils 3-0 back in September.

However, off the pitch, Slot, 46, has still had to deal with some high-profile controversies during his short time at the club. As you may well know, Trent Alexander-Arnold, Mohamed Salah and Virgil van Dijk are all out of contract at the end of the 2024/25 season, and now that the transfer window is open, they can enter talks regarding a pre-contract agreement with foreign clubs.

But a forgotten man could be set to return to the club with Liverpool ‘in talks’ to terminate his current loan deal, according to Rousing The Kop.

The outlet reports that the Reds are in talks with RB Salzburg about cutting short Stefan Bajcetic’s loan. Bajcetic, 20, has made 12 Austrian Bundesliga appearances this season but has failed to produce a single goal or assist for the club.

It was thought that his loan was influenced by former Liverpool assistant coach Pepijn Lijnders, who was head coach at Salzburg at the start of the season but has since parted company with the club.

In October, Austrian outlet Krone reported that the Spaniard left his fellow players ‘astonished' by continually being called up to the starting XI despite not performing well on the pitch.

He was even fined by the club for being late to a training session. Now, Rousing The Kop reports that he has removed all mention of Salzburg from his Instagram and is ‘no longer happy’ at the Austrian side.

It is still unclear whether he would be part of Slot’s plans or be loaned to another club, with TBR explaining that Liverpool are “now in advanced discussion” with La Liga side Real Betis regarding a potential move.

Fabrizio Romano also issued an update on the news via X.

“Real Betis are in advanced talks to sign Stefan Bajcetic on a loan deal from Liverpool,” he wrote.

“Not done yet but progressing”
